UK group Everyone Hates Elon went viral for posting parody ads for Tesla's "Swasticar" with an image of Musk making a Nazi ...
President Donald Trump said Russian leader Vladimir Putin would accept European peacekeepers in Ukraine as part of a ...
US tariffs on North American and EU imports could cut automaker profit by $3,500-$10,000 per vehicle, according to our ...
Tesla is recalling almost 376,000 vehicles, according to the National Highway Traffic Safety Administration. For a complete list of recalled vehicles or to see if your car needs repairs, check the ...